原文:ctf中rsa攻擊方法

RSA攻擊 ctf中常見的rsa攻擊方式有以下幾種 低加密指數攻擊 低加密指數廣播攻擊 低解密指數攻擊 共模攻擊 已知高位攻擊 x 低加密指數攻擊 當e過小時,如果明文過小,導致明文的三次方仍然小於n,那么通過直接對密文三次開方,即可得到明文。 如果明文的三次方比n大,但不夠大,那么設k,有: c m e kn 爆破k,如果 c kn 能開三次根式,那么可以直接得到明文。 x 低加密指數廣播攻擊 ...

2019-09-18 19:15 0 1358 推薦指數:

查看詳情

[CTF] RSA共模攻擊

原理 引子 假設有一家公司COMPANY,在員工通信系統中用RSA加密消息。COMPANY首先生成了兩個大質數P,Q,取得PQ乘積N。並且以N為模數,生成多對不同的公鑰及其相應的私鑰。COMPANY將所有公鑰公開。而不同的員工獲得自己的私鑰,比如,員工 ...

Wed Dec 19 17:30:00 CST 2018 0 1423
CTFRSA 算法

1.質數(素數)是指在大於1的自然數,除了1和它本身以外不再有其他因數的自然數。 2.合數是指比1大但不是素數的數 3.約數(因數)整數a除以整數b(b≠0) 除得的商正好是整數而沒有余數,我們就說a能被b整除,或b能整除a。a稱為 b的倍數,b稱為a的約數 4.互質數:如果兩個整數a,b的最大 ...

Mon Jul 27 17:13:00 CST 2020 0 1084
CTFRSA套路

前言 RSA是在CTF中經常出現的一類題目。一般難度不高,並且有一定的套路。(10.1補:我錯了,我不配!我不配密碼學)在此我寫篇文章進行總結。本文不過多贅述RSA的加解密, 僅從做題角度提供方法。雖然說不贅述加解密,但是我們還是需要清楚在RSA里面的幾個基本參數。 N:大整數N ...

Wed Aug 12 18:42:00 CST 2020 0 6073
CTFRSA常見類型解法

Python腳本 在線分解大整數網址,先將n轉換為10進制。 http://www.factordb.com/index.php 1.兩組數e相同,n,c不同, 求出n1與n2的最大公因數即為p,之后就可以得到q和d,從而求解m。 有個題,名字為二合一,兩段代碼組合即為flag ...

Tue Jun 01 02:46:00 CST 2021 0 1372
RSA相關知識點與攻擊方法

相關工具/方法 大數分解 大數分解網頁 http://www.factordb.com/index.php yafu 運行yafu-x64.exe,在窗口中輸入factor(n),n即為待分解的大數。 在factor.log中找到分解結果。 利用z3解方程 可以加快解題 ...

Thu Jul 30 01:38:00 CST 2020 0 1143
CTFRSA題目的pem文件處理

需要用到工具opensll(現在版本的kali里面會自帶openssl) Pem文件分析:其中每個元素對應的RSA的元素 私鑰 RSAPrivateKey ::= SEQUENCE { version Version, modulus INTEGER, -- n ...

Thu Sep 26 06:25:00 CST 2019 0 333
RSA解密(CTF

RSA解密(CTF) http://www.factordb.com/ 求解D: 解密腳本 ...

Mon Sep 28 06:48:00 CST 2020 0 581
RSA攻擊大全及其實現

一、RSA攻擊大全 1. 模數分解 Small q:模數N有小素數因子; fermat:模數N的因子p與q非常接近; 模不互素:給出多組公鑰,但是其中的模數共用了素因子; 2. 針對指數進行攻擊 小公鑰指數攻擊:指數很小; 低加密指數廣播攻擊:相同的消息發送給 ...

Sat Aug 15 06:50:00 CST 2020 1 1825
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M